The Rt. Rev. Stanley Ntagali is the new archbishop of the Church of Uganda. He takes over from outgoing Archbishop Henry Luke Orombi in December. The House of Bishops, comprising leaders of the 34 dioceses in the country, elected the new Archbishop. Ntagali becomes the eighth person to assume the seat in the history of the Church of Uganda. The new Archbishop will also serve as the Diocesan Bishop of Kampala diocese as well as Archbishop of the entire Church of Uganda.
